Pose accuracy is an important issue for parallel robot being used as mirror supporting system of telescope. One challenging topic is the accuracy synthesis which deals with the optimal design of the manufacturing and assembling tolerances of each component under the given pose accuracy. First
the error model of the 3-RPS parallel robot is built based on total derivation of the kinematic equations. And the error variable of each spherical or rotate joint can be expressed as a single boundary error parameter but not three independent position parameters. Then
the accuracy synthesis model is formulated taking the manufacturing costs as the optimization objective and the accuracy requirements as the constraint condition. Finally
the genetic algorithm is used to solve the optimization problem and a simulation example is given. The results show that the accuracy synthesis method based on manufacturing costs can satisfy the need of pose accuracy and is better for engineering application than the method based on error sensitivity. 2012 Chinese Assoc of Automati.

Measuring the movement of raster by the method of moire fringe has the advantage of high sensitivity
high resolution and non-contacted measurement. The characteristic of moire fringe is that the image is white alternate with black
the angle of the stripes is uniform
the width of the stripes is uniform
the terminators of the stripes aren't clear. A fast method that can figure out the width and angle of the moire fringe precisely is put forward in this paper. It calculates the angle the stripes firstly. According to the principle of the minimum mean squared error (MMSE)
the closer a series of data is
the smaller the value of the MMSE will be. The method is described as follows: It takes the image's center as the origin
180 beelines pass through the origin with the same angle interval. it calculates the value of the minimum mean squared error of the 180 beelines and find out the least one among those
then the angle of the moire fringe comes out primarily. In order to improving the calculating precision of moire fringe
60 equal angles are divided in the neighborhood of the angle
then a precise angle of moire fringe is calculated according to the principle of the MMSE. After getting out the angle of the moire fringe
we begin to calculate the width of moire fringe. A line vertical with the moire fringe is drawn
and we can get the width of the moire fringe by the vertical line. In order to get over the influence of the noise
an effective area with the shape of diamond is selected in the image. The data of area is accumulated and projected according to the direction of moire fringe
and a sine curve come out. The width of moire fringe can be obtained by getting the position of the first wave crest
the position of the last wave crest and the number of wave crest. Experiments prove that the precision of the method put forward in this paper is enhanced in comparison with the traditional frequency method
the precision of width calculation achieves to 99.6% according to the evaluation indicators of width detection error. The computing speed is boosted largely compared with traditional method
and it can achieve with 15 ms
that satisfying the demand of real time. 2011 SPIE.
